Indies Finite Films & TV and Shoni Productions have appointed Aaron Anderson ("Dangerous Liaisons") as Head of Scripted Development to oversee and develop their growing scripted slates. Aaron Anderson brings two decades of experience in high-end scripted development and production to his new role at Finite Films & TV. Most recently, he served at Sir Colin Callender’s Playground Entertainment, as Script Producer on the period drama "Dangerous Liaisons" for Starz.
Working alongside Finite Films & TV’s founder and executive producer, Amy Gardner and the wider scripted team to bolster the company’s scripted slate, Anderson will overview its portfolio of projects currently in development. The company slate includes the feature "Brides" directed by Nadia Fall, which premiered at Sundance earlier this year. Finite Films & TV’s Amy Gardner is an executive producer on the film.
Aaron will also be heading up scripted development for executive producer Dana Høegh’s Shoni Productions. In 2024, Shoni co-produced Ruthy Pribar’s "What Is to Come" alongside Gum Film in Israel and served as executive producer for feature "The Black Sea" and upcoming releases "Titanic Ocean" and "Apart from Her". Shoni are currently developing multiple feature film and high-end TV drama projects.
